The tuition fee for the MSF30322 – Certificate III in Cabinet Making and Timber Technology is $9,000, and there is an additional material fee of $1,000. For more information about tuition fees and other charges, you can contact the college directly.
Students receive hands-on practical training in simulated or real workshop environments, including access to cabinet making and timber technology workshops, industry-standard woodworking machinery and hand tools, timber materials, sheet goods, and hardware, finishing and surface preparation equipment, Personal Protective Equipment (PPE), and experienced trainers and learner support services.

Recognition of Prior Learning (RPL) is available for students with relevant industry experience and suitable evidence, and Credit Transfer is granted for equivalent units previously completed as part of other nationally recognised qualifications. Applications should be submitted prior to or at enrolment, and RPL assessments may incur additional fees.
Graduates may continue further study in MSF40122 – Certificate IV in Furniture Design and Technology, MSF50122 – Diploma of Furniture Design and Technology, or other construction, furniture design, or business-related qualifications. This qualification also supports pathways into licensed trade work, supervisory roles, and self-employment within the cabinet making and timber products industry.
Assessment is competency-based and may include practical demonstrations of cabinet making and timber technology tasks, written and oral knowledge assessments, production of cabinet or furniture items to specification, portfolio and photographic evidence, and direct observation and third-party reports. All assessments are mapped to industry standards and monitored by qualified assessors.
